Irving is a bustling city located in Texas, USA. It is conveniently located near international airports, major highways, and railways, which make it a hub for transportation and commerce. The city has various opportunities for personal and professional development, including a wide range of courses and programs available to residents and visitors. One of the most prominent educational institutions in Irving is the North Lake College. North Lake College is part of the Dallas County Community College District and offers various education programs to students, both on-campus and online. The college offers associate degrees, certificates, and continuing education courses that cater to different fields of study, including business, health sciences, engineering, and sciences. In addition to North Lake College, Irving also has several other educational institutions that offer adult education courses to residents and visitors. The Irving Independent School District provides community education courses that include business, computer skills, visual and fine arts, and real estate courses. Moreover, there are also numerous vocational schools in Irving that offer specialized courses, including the Aviation Institute of Maintenance, which provides programs in aircraft maintenance and repair, and Southern Careers Institute, which provides trade courses in allied health, business, and skilled trades. Apart from educational institutions, Irving has several organizations and groups that offer professional development programs to employees. These organizations help workers in Irving to remain competitive in their respective fields and enhance their skills to promote personal and professional growth. For instance, the Greater Irving-Las Colinas Chamber of Commerce hosts regular career development and networking programs for professionals in various industries. Besides, the International Association of Administrative Professionals (IAAP) has a chapter in Irving that provides administrative assistants with professional development opportunities. Furthermore, technology plays a significant role in professional development, and Irving has several resources available for individuals to enhance their technology skills. The City of Irving offers comprehensive computer courses, including Microsoft Office Applications, graphic design, web development, and cybersecurity. Additionally, the Irving Public Library system provides free computer and internet access and offers educational resources to help users improve their digital skills.
